Sumitomo F-50 series represents a critical line of helium compressors designed for high-performance cryogenic systems, specifically those utilizing Gifford-McMahon cryocoolers and pulse tubes. These compressors are widely used in medical and scientific applications, including MRI systems such as GE HealthCare’s Signa and Discovery series. Core Specifications
The F-50 is a mid-sized, water-cooled unit available in two primary electrical configurations to accommodate global power standards: F-50L (Low Voltage): Runs on 3-phase 200V at 50/60 Hz. F-50H (High Voltage):
Supports 3-phase 380/400/415V at 50 Hz and 460/480V at 60 Hz. Specification Power Consumption 6.5–7.2 kW (50 Hz); 7.5–8.3 kW (60 Hz) Physical Dimensions 591 x 450 x 585 mm (approx. 23.3" x 17.7" x 23") 120 kg (approx. 264 lbs) Maintenance Cycle 30,000 hours (improved over previous series) Cooling Requirement Water-cooled; 7–10 L/min (1.8–2.6 gal/min) Operational Workflow

The Sumitomo F-50 compressor is a critical component in high-performance cryogenic systems, specifically designed to power Sumitomo Heavy Industries (SHI) Gifford-McMahon (GM) cryocoolers. This water-cooled, three-phase compressor serves as the "heart" of the refrigeration cycle, providing the high-pressure helium gas necessary to achieve temperatures as low as 4K. Understanding its manual is essential for ensuring operational efficiency, safety, and equipment longevity. Technical Specifications and Function
The F-50 is engineered for continuous, long-term operation. It functions by compressing low-pressure helium returned from the cold head and discharging it at a higher pressure. A key feature of the F-50 is its integrated oil-lubrication system. Since cryocoolers require ultra-pure helium, the compressor utilizes a sophisticated multi-stage filtration and oil separation process. This ensures that no oil vapor reaches the cold head, which would otherwise freeze and cause a system failure. Installation and Safety
The manual emphasizes proper environment and connectivity. Because the F-50 is water-cooled, it requires a steady flow of cooling water within a specific temperature and pressure range. Insufficient cooling can lead to overheating and automatic thermal shutdowns. Electrical safety is also paramount; the unit operates on 200-480V (depending on the specific sub-model), requiring dedicated circuit protection and proper phase sequencing to prevent the pump from running in reverse. Routine Maintenance: The Adsorber
Perhaps the most critical maintenance item outlined in the manual is the replacement of the adsorber. The adsorber is the final line of defense against oil contamination. Over time, the charcoal inside the adsorber becomes saturated with oil vapor. The manual typically mandates replacement every 20,000 to 30,000 operating hours. Neglecting this window risks contaminating the entire gas circuit, leading to costly repairs and system decontamination. Troubleshooting and Indicators

Low Gas Pressure: Often caused by minor leaks in the self-sealing aeroquip couplings.
High Discharge Temperature: Usually linked to cooling water failure or high ambient temperatures.
